About Deutsche Bahn Bahnbau Gruppe GmbH
DB Bahnbau Gruppe GmbH is the comprehensive service provider responsible for planning, building, and maintaining the railway infrastructure of Deutsche Bahn. Operating in over 40 locations throughout Germany, it manages track construction, technical equipment, structural engineering, and coordinates large-scale projects. The company focuses on innovative and environmentally friendly modernization of rail infrastructure to support future generations.
Position Overview
We are currently seeking an Estimator specializing in railway infrastructure for various locations including Bad Kleinen, Berlin, Essen, Freiburg, Halle (Saale), Hanau, or Hannover. Join us to contribute to building a robust rail network for the future.
Key Responsibilities
- Assess and evaluate bidding documents as a core task.
- Calculate planning and assembly services specifically for overhead line systems.
- Conduct risk analyses during the bidding process.
- Identify potential additional claims from tender documents and collaborate with construction and project management for cost evaluation.
- Request price quotes from subcontractors during acquisition phases.
- Coordinate tender contents with internal departments and external partners in close cooperation with work preparation.
- Participate actively in contract and price negotiations.
Candidate Profile
- Completed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ering, Industrial Engineering, or a related field; alternatively, a Master Craftsman or Technician qualification in construction.
- Several years of professional experience as an estimator or in a related role.
- Proficiency in calculation methodologies and systems; solid knowledge of VOB, VOL, HOAI, BGB, and AGB regulations.
- Experience with the iTWO calculation software is advantageous.
- Strong communication skills, teamwork orientation, and negotiation capabilities.
- High motivation, resilience, and ability to perform under deadline pressure.
- Willingness to undertake minor travel as required.
